The La Junta Tigers will square off against the Manitou Springs Mustangs at 1:00 p.m. on Saturday. The teams are rolling into the game with opposing streaks: La Junta has struggled recently with five defeats in a row, while Manitou Springs will arrive with four straight victories.

La Junta is coming in off a wild two-game stretch: after soaring to 14 runs on April 8th, they were much more limited against Pueblo County two weeks ago. They lost 9-1 to the Hornets.

Meanwhile, Manitou Springs made easy work of St. Mary's on Tuesday and carried off an 11-5 win.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est victory the Mustangs have posted against the Pirates since May 20, 2016.

Maxton Bolster made a splash no matter where he played. On the mound, he didn't allow a single earned run while striking out nine over four innings pitched. He also tossed no earned runs, which is notable because Manitou Springs is 4-2 when he allows at most two earned runs, but 3-5 otherwise. Bolster was also big at the plate, going 1-for-4 with two RBI and one run.

In other batting news, Hayden Martinez was incredible, getting on base in four of his five plate appearances with five stolen bases and three runs. Those five stolen bases gave him a new career-high. Another player making a difference was Preston Rhodes, who went 2-for-4 with one stolen base, two RBI, and one double.

Manitou Springs pushed their record up to 7-7 with the win, which was their fourth straight at home. Those home vict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 10.5 runs over those games. As for La Junta, their loss dropped their record down to 3-11.
